I am looking for Voltage-to-Current Converter Evaluation Kit for one of my test bench setup, accuracy is not that important. Output current of range 0 to 25mA and max input voltage available is 12V so a varying voltage of 0 to 5V or 0-10V can be made available. I am in need of two channel circuit and as it is test bench setup i am expecting a cheaper option/solution. 

  • The simplest voltage to current converter may be set up using an op amp, FET transistor and a current setting resistor - see below.

    Below Fig 1 shows V-I converter with Vin in the range of 0 to 10V resulting in 0 to 25mA sinking current (Iout=Vin/400).  Fig 2 shows V-I converter with Vin in the range of 0 to 5V resulting in 0 to 25mA sourcing current (Iout=Vin/200).  The voltage/current ranges may easily be adjusted with R1 and R2 resistors.
